A clear and powerful weblog application powered with Django
Project description
Simple yet powerful and really extendable application for managing a blog within your Django Web site.
Zinnia has been made for publishing Weblog entries and designed to do it well.
Basically any feature that can be provided by another reusable app has been left out. Why should we re-implement something that is already done and reviewed by others and tested?
Features
More than a long speech, here the list of the main features:
Comments
Archives views
Related entries
Private entries
RSS or Atom Feeds
Tags and categories views
Prepublication and expiration
Editing in Markdown, Textile or reStructuredText
Widgets (Popular entries, Similar entries, …)
Admin dashboard
Ping Directories
Ping External links
Bit.ly support
Twitter support
Gravatar support
Django-CMS plugins
Collaborative work
Tags autocompletion
Pingback/Trackback support
Efficient database queries
Ready to use and extendable templates
Windows Live Writer compatibility
Examples
Take a look at the online demo at: http://demo.django-blog-zinnia.com/ or you can visit these websites who use Zinnia.
If you are a proud user of Zinnia, send me the URL of your website and I will add it to the list.
Online resources
More information and help available at these URLs:
Discussions and help at Google Group
For reporting a bug use GitHub Issues
0.20
Remove compatibility with Django 1.x
Remove code for Python 2.0
Documentation improvements
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.19…v0.20
0.19
Compatibility with Django 1.11
Fix Threading issues in tests
Improve comparison of entries
Send mail to staff in case of comment moderation
Implement spam-checkers on Pingbacks and Trackbacks
Return the number of entries in the category_tree templatetag
Integration via BrowserSync
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.18.1…v0.19
0.18.1
Fix messed relationships in Python 3
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.18…v0.18.1
0.18
Compatibility with Django 1.10
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.17…v0.18
0.17
Compatibility with Django 1.9
Fix RSS enclosure
Fix paginator issue
Implement Entry.lead_html method
Usage of regex module to speed up
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.16…v0.17
0.16
Improve testing
Improve documentation
Reduce queries on entry_detail_view
Implement custom templates within a loop
Add a publication_date field to remove ambiguosity
Remove WXR template
Remove usage of Context
Remove BeautifulSoup warnings
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.15.2…v0.16
0.15.2
Covering of the code at 100%
Compatibility with Django 1.8
Improvements on the Calendar
Improvements on CategoryFeed
Improvements on Entry.save()
Improvements on ping of external URLs
Improvements on the comparison module
Improvements on the translation strings
The default theme is now in HTML5
The default theme supports Microdatas
Add a lead field on the Entry model
Add an image_caption field on the Entry model
Fix preview of entries when not yet published
Fix migrations when using custom User model
More generic parameter for MarkDown extensions
Import utilies were moved to their own package
The fields where the search is done are now configurable
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.15.1…v0.15.2
0.15.1
Documentation improvements
Fix migration issues with Django 1.7
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.15…v0.15.1
0.15
Django 1.6 is no longer supported.
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.14.3…v0.15
0.14.3
Improvement on the default theme * RSS links * Better translations * Correct title markup * Fix anchors for linkbacks
Reorder the provided statics
Rename zinnia_tags to zinnia
Fix calendar in archive day view
Fix Textitle rendering on Python 3
Fix feeds for authors with accents
Fix admin issue with custom Entry model
Do not include anymore jQuery in admin for entries
Admin tag autocompletion with a widget based on select2
Configurable upload path for image field with inheritance
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.14.2…v0.14.3
0.14.2
Optimize sitemap page
Smarter widont filter
Fix issue on pagination
Fix several admin issues
Fix short link for unpublished entries
Integration with Gulp.js
HTML and CSS fixes on default theme
Tested under PostGres and MySQL and SQLite
URLs are now under the zinnia namespace
Move Twitter support to zinnia-twitter
Move Mollom support to zinnia-spam-checker-mollom
Move Akismet support to zinnia-spam-checker-akismet
Move Bit.ly support to zinnia-url-shortener-bitly
Move TinyMCE support to zinnia-wysiwyg-tinymce
Move MarkItUp support to zinnia-wysiwyg-markitup
Move WYMEditor support to zinnia-wysiwyg-wymeditor
Use django_comments instead of django.contrib.comments
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.14.1…v0.14.2
0.14.1
Fix dates on WXR export
Fix blogger2zinnia unicode issue
Fix unicode issue on Category admin
Fix URL errors with custom comment app
Full support of custom User model
Metrics for the content previews
More useable pagination
More blocks for customizing reactions
Minor documentation updates
Minor fixes for default skin
Review admin form for editing the entries
Restricted preview for unpublished entries
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.14…v0.14.1
0.14
Full Python 3.0 support
Django 1.5 is no longer supported
Better support of custom User model
Improvements on the archives by week
Fix timezone issues in templatetags and archives
Database query optimizations in the archives views
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.13…v0.14
0.13
Start Python 3.0 support
Display page number in list
Basic support of custom User
Django 1.4 is no longer supported
https://github.com/Fantomas42/django-blog-zinnia/compare/v0.12.3…v0.13
0.12.3
Better skeleton.html
Better rendering for the slider
Add view for having a random entry
Compatibility fix with Django 1.5 in admin
Fix issue with author detail view paginated
Better settings for ZINNIA_AUTO_CLOSE_*_AFTER
0.12.2
CSS updates and fixes
Fix viewport meta tag
I18n support for the URLs
Update MarkItUp to v1.1.13
Update WYMeditor to v1.0.0b3
Entry’s content can be blank
Compatibility fix for WXR > 1.0
Fix potential issue on check_is_spam
0.12.1
Microformats improved
Improve Blogger importer
Finest control on linkbacks
Split Entry model into mixins
Compatibility fix with Django 1.5
Custom template for content rendering
Fix Python 2.7 issues with wp2zinnia
0.12
Optimizations on the templates
Optimizations on the database queries
Denormalization of the comments
get_authors context improved
get_tag_cloud context improved
get_categories context improved
Default theme declinations
Default theme more responsive
Updating helloworld.json fixture
Fix issues with authors in wp2zinnia
Better integration of the comments system
Models has been splitted into differents modules
0.11.2
New admin filter for authors
Minor translation improvements
Minor documentation improvements
wp2zinnia handle wxr version 1.2
Customizations of the templates with ease
Define a custom Author.__unicode__ method
Fix issue with duplicate spam comments
Fix bug in PreviousNextPublishedMixin
Fix bug in QuickEntry with non ascii title
Fix collectstatic with CachedStaticFilesStorage
0.11.1
Fix issues with get_absolute_url and zbreadcrumbs when time-zone support is enabled.
0.11
Class-based views
Time zones support
Pagination on archives
Better archive by week view
Update of the breadcrumbs tag
Improving wp2zinnia command
New long_enough spam checker
Custom templates for archive views
Publication dates become unrequired
No runtime warnings on Django 1.4
Django 1.3 is no longer supported
And a lot of bug fixes
0.10.1
Django 1.4 compatibility support
Compatibility with django-mptt >= 5.1
zinnia.plugins is now removed
0.10
Better default templates
CSS refactoring with Sass3
Statistics about the content
Improvement of the documentation
Entry’s Meta options can be extended
Django 1.2 is no longer supported
zinnia.plugins is deprecated in favor of cmsplugin_zinnia
And a lot of bug fixes
0.9
Improved URL shortening
Improved moderation system
Better support of django-tagging
Blogger to Zinnia utility command
OpenSearch capabilities
Upgraded search engine
Feed to Zinnia utility command
And a lot of bug fixes
0.8
Admin dashboard
Featured entries
Using Microformats
Mails for comment reply
Entry model can be extended
More plugins for django-cms
Zinnia to Wordpress utility command
Code cleaning and optimizations
And a lot of bug fixes
0.7
Using signals
Trackback support
Ping external URLs
Private posts
Hierarchical categories
TinyMCE integration
Code optimizations
And a lot of bug fixes
0.6
Handling PingBacks
Support MetaWeblog API
Passing to Django 1.2.x
Breadcrumbs templatetag
Bug correction in calendar widget
Wordpress to Zinnia utility command
Major bug correction on publication system
And a lot of bug fixes
0.5
Packaging
Tests added
Translations
Better templates
New templatetags
Plugins for django-cms
Twitter and Bit.ly support
Publishing sources on Github.com
0.4 and before
The previous versions of Zinnia were not packaged, and were destinated for a personnal use.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file django-blog-zinnia-0.20.tar.gz
.
File metadata
- Download URL: django-blog-zinnia-0.20.tar.gz
- Upload date:
- Size: 700.6 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| c99d8239cb9c24869f41ba2266f7f0b5de72f5709fc15782d35cc061d2d7554d |
|
MD5 | 38973042aa98c87bdd725899b97b1aba |
|
BLAKE2b-256 | f5de2a2f48f4bc0e242ab30183d37c8142ca95659e541461332953ea0c0b49ae |
File details
Details for the file django_blog_zinnia-0.20-py2.py3-none-any.whl
.
File metadata
- Download URL: django_blog_zinnia-0.20-py2.py3-none-any.whl
- Upload date:
- Size: 792.6 kB
- Tags: Python 2, Python 3
- Uploaded using Trusted Publishing? No
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| ff570fb21fad39e998f84a2700099067579e4ca435c1718366e109e31115dfff |
|
MD5 | d52a6dfae8166e0967f3e71da8da8d51 |
|
BLAKE2b-256 | 7af3847ea355297741a5a8290f5d25b1be8847940f8d115b6bca5e96a57fe950 |